### Step 4: Register the schedule in Flowharbor

With the legacy cron entries exported, each job becomes a Flowharbor workflow with an explicit schedule, retry policy, and owner tag. Do not copy crontab lines verbatim; Flowharbor evaluates schedules in the tenant's zone, not UTC. Register the workflow, then pin it to the shared worker pool. The scheduler expects the following configuration values.

settings of kajeg-kafop:
OLIWYN_HOST=oliwyn.qorvelsys.internal
OLIWYN_PORT=9000

Deep-link routing: Lumeva app. If users report links opening the home screen instead of the target view, check the route registry first. Common causes: stale manifest cache, unverified domain association, or a malformed path segment. Steps: 1) Ask for the exact link. 2) Confirm the scheme matches lumeva:// or the verified web domain. 3) Reproduce on a clean install. 4) If routing still fails, escalate to the Pathfinder team with device model and OS version. Include the token shown below in your escalation.

trace token, fafog-kageg: htk4_98e6

## Authentication

Quick context: the N+1 fix in Shelfwing's GraphQL layer moved resolver batching behind the internal Dataloom service, so auth now happens there instead of per-query. For release builds, make sure the pipeline injects the Dataloom credential before the schema check runs, or the batch step silently falls back to the slow path. Drop the key below into the release env.

service key, fawip-bajef: kto11_Qt5wZK9vdNC

# DeployBot Session Handling

DeployBot holds one session per channel. Sessions expire after 30 minutes idle; the bot re-auths silently on next query.

**Common issues:**
- Stale session → `/deploybot reset` clears it.
- "Status unavailable" usually means the Relayn gateway dropped the session; reset fixes it.
- Duplicate replies: two sessions racing. Reset both channels.

Never restart the bot pod to fix sessions — it wipes the deploy cache.

For manual API calls during an outage, authenticate with the on-call bearer token below.

login token, bagug-kafop: eyJhbGciOiJIUzI1NiIsInR5cCI6IkpXVCJ9.eyJzdWIiOiIcMLov2In0.Z5RLDIfp